Staying Updated: HR’s Guide to Income Tax Law Changes

Introduction

Navigating income tax laws is crucial for HR professionals to ensure compliance and provide accurate information to employees. Tax laws are dynamic, often reflecting policy changes that impact payroll processes, employee benefits, and overall company compliance. This guide aims to equip HR professionals with strategies and resources to stay updated on income tax law changes.

Understanding the Importance

  1. Compliance: Adhering to the latest tax laws helps prevent legal penalties and fines.
  2. Employee Trust: Accurate tax withholding and reporting build trust between employees and the HR department.
  3. Operational Efficiency: Staying updated minimizes disruptions caused by unexpected tax law changes.

Key Areas Affected by Tax Law Changes

  1. Payroll Processing: Changes in tax rates, brackets, and withholding rules.
  2. Employee Benefits: Impacts on retirement plans, healthcare benefits, and fringe benefits.
  3. Reporting Requirements: Modifications in filing deadlines, forms, and documentation.

Strategies for Staying Updated

  1. Subscribe to Government Updates:
    • IRS Notifications: Subscribe to IRS newsletters and alerts for the latest updates on federal tax laws.
    • State Tax Agencies: Follow your state’s tax agency for state-specific changes.
  2. Leverage Professional Networks:
    • HR Associations: Join organizations like SHRM (Society for Human Resource Management) for updates and resources.
    • Tax Professional Groups: Network with tax professionals who can provide insights into upcoming changes.
  3. Utilize Technology:
    • Tax Software: Invest in payroll and tax software that updates automatically with tax law changes.
    • Webinars and Online Training: Participate in webinars and online courses focusing on tax law updates.
  4. Consult Legal and Tax Experts:
    • Regular Meetings: Schedule regular meetings with tax advisors and legal consultants to discuss potential changes.
    • Internal Training: Organize training sessions for the HR team to understand new tax laws and their implications.
  5. Monitor Legislative Developments:
    • News Outlets: Follow reputable news sources that cover legislative changes in tax laws.
    • Government Websites: Regularly check websites like Congress.gov for updates on pending tax legislation.

Implementing Changes

  1. Review and Adjust Payroll Systems:
    • Update payroll systems to reflect new tax rates and withholding rules.
    • Test the system to ensure accuracy in tax calculations.
  2. Communicate with Employees:
    • Send out detailed communications explaining the changes and how they affect employees’ paychecks.
    • Offer informational sessions or Q&A forums for employees to address their concerns.
  3. Update Internal Policies and Procedures:
    • Revise internal documentation to incorporate the latest tax laws.
    • Ensure that all HR staff are informed and trained on the new procedures.
